Output d0bb1dd2ffe06b60195c72a711e4081d1b4fb09887766adcbd2f7cffa183579f:2

value
680512
script pubkey
OP_0 OP_PUSHBYTES_20 e360c09bf156c7d9624c33d0c2f5cbcbc9479dbb
address
bc1qudsvpxl32mrajcjvx0gv9awte0y508dm7vrxs5
transaction
d0bb1dd2ffe06b60195c72a711e4081d1b4fb09887766adcbd2f7cffa183579f
confirmations
150268
spent
true